不可能的生态:生态社区的相互作用网络和共存的稳定性

概括
生态社区可以实现稳定的物种共存,但网络结构是关键. 这项研究表明,互动的安排,而不仅仅是它们的类型,显著影响社区的稳定性.

背景情况:
- 了解稳定的物种共存是系统生态学的一个基本挑战.
- 现有的方法很难将生态相互作用的完整网络结构 (竞争,互惠,掠食者-猎物) 纳入其中.
研究的目的:
- 分析互动网络结构对生态社区稳定的影响.
- 确定在生态网络中可能或不可能存在稳定的物种共存的条件.
主要方法:
- 使用洛特卡-沃尔特拉动力学分析N≤5种所有可能的相互作用网络.
- 准确的数学结果与数值探索的结合.
- 统计抽样以评估不同网络安排之间稳定共存的概率.
主要成果:
- 确定了一小部分"不可能的生态",其中稳定的共存是不可能的.
- 证明了稳定的共存的可能性是由罕见的"不可缩减的生态".
- 证明网络结构,而不仅仅是相互作用类型的比例,显著影响稳定性.
结论:
- 网络内的生态相互作用的具体安排是社区稳定的关键决定因素.
- 稳定共存的概率根据网络拓学大大不同,即使具有相同的交互类型.
- 这项工作通过网络分析为了解生态稳定提供了一个新的框架.

Ecological Niches
24.6K
All organisms have a position within an ecosystem. The complete set of living and nonliving factors—including food resources, climate, and terrain—that define the position of a given organism are collectively referred to as the organism’s ecological niche.

Ecological Disturbance
17.5K
An ecological disturbance is a temporary disruption in the environment resulting from abiotic, biotic, or anthropogenic factors, causing a pronounced change in an ecosystem. The impact of an ecological disturbance, which can depend on its intensity, frequency, and spatial distribution, plays a significant role in shaping the species diversity within the ecosystem.
